The largest telescope in the world, who will order several sizes exceed all previous giant to look to the stars, will be built on the mountain Cerro Armazones (3060m above sea level) in Chile, it was decided on 26 April at the meeting held at the European Southern Observatory (ESO).

After thorough testing several potential sites around the world Cerro Armazones is rated as the best place to accommodate the giant world has not seen any. No small role played by the fact that the sky is clear during the 320 days a year and it is close (twenty miles), another "astronomical top" Cerro Paranal, where telescopes are located in the VLT-VLTI system.
E-ELT (European Extremely Large Telescope) will be a giant mirror with a diameter of up to 42m. The previous largest telescopes in the world have a mirror diameter of ten meters, and the famous Hubble Space Telescope "only" 2.4m!
E-ELT will have a mass of over 5.000tona! His course will be a mirror The cast in one piece but will be set to the correct structure even 984 small mirrors to the precision engineering and computer control to work as an equivalent single telescope mirror diameter of 42m.
Six special laser will generate artificial stars in order to ensure perfect navigation telescopes but they will primarily serve to opto-electronic equipment "used my" atmospheric turbulence and neutralize interference which will ultimately give a hundred times better performance than the latest editions Hubble Space Telescope!

It is believed that the E-ELT will allow astronomers to see the ISK and planets around other stars, as well as monitoring activities (detection of stellar spots) on the stars in our galaxy. You will be able to clearly distinguish and record individual stars in close GCs even in other galaxies of the local group. Construction jobs around the telescope and the supporting infrastructure will start later this year and I have a telescope should be operational in 2018th Cost of construction is estimated to be at least a billion of euros, which are part of the funds already secured.

Pluto, the former ninth planet of the Solar System has been translated into the assembly of the International Astronomical Union, 2006th the category of so-called. dwarf planet. Research proposals and the Australian National University (ANU) on the categorization of bodies belonging to the solar system move in the direction that the status of dwarf planet get all objects with a diameter greater than 200 km (previously 400 km), which would automatically contributed to a group of planets that dwarfs suddenly "grow" the more fifty objects.

Globally renowned icon of modern astronomy, the Hubble Space Telescope (HST), celebrated her birthday yesterday. Launched on 24 April 1990. The board the Discovery after several years of delay due to technical and safety problems in some of the telescope and shuttle.

HST is 25 April 1990. was released from the cargo space shuttle Discovery and then began his independent way outer space. A few weeks later, when he took his orbit a 600-km above the Earth, and they received the first pictures. Because of errors in making the mirror telescope Hubble a few years ago was "shortsighted." But the mission engineers were able to solve in the first service mission 1993rd Over the years there were a total of five service missions where instruments HSTu modernized and extended life for over two decades. It is estimated to be operational for at least another few years until the end of this decade, it does not replace the more powerful James Webb Space Telescope.
It is estimated that the total cost HSTa over six billion!

Several newly discovered planets around other stars, and careful study of several well-known of them earlier on the way to overthrow the generally accepted theory about the formation of planetary systems in the universe. At the national conference of the British astronomer (Royal Astronomical Society National Astronomy Meeting) held in Glasgow in a group of students and professionals (Andrew Cameron, Amaury Triaud, Andrew Cameron, Didier Queloz and others) presented the discovery of nine newly found planets around other stars, bringing the number of known planets in the universe climbed to number 452, plus eight known planets around our star.

But what is more interesting than that is finding ways of their orbits around the parent star. Six of twenty-seven carefully researched extrasolar planet around its parent star turns opposite of gentle rotation! It is now considered an excluded the possibility of early evolution of planets. Theoretical and computational models of astronomers assumed that the protoplanetarni disks and planets around young stem Suns must rotate in the same direction as the star rotates on its axis. But these six extrasolar planet rotates in the direction of them otherwise! You could say that this is a "glove challenge" for modern astronomy and astronomers now have the difficult task to explain this unusual situation. Is such orbits cause strong gravitational effect of two or more planets, which are able to enter a "mess" in the movement of celestial bodies, or something else entirely (a close passage of a star), now becomes the subject of speculation and new research.

The system radiotelescope LOFAR (Low Frequency Array) initiated by Dutch scientists and approved in several European countries began mapping the universe while he was still a baby. Scanning the sky in a very short radio waves is almost uncharted territory, and astronomers hope to get answers to questions related to the birth of the first stars and galaxies and radio communication capabilities extraterrestrial civilizations!

LOFAR has no moving antenna and thus not demanding management system. A large number of individual minor antenna is positioned on a special pedestal in the country. The antennas are positioned and oriented toward a specific position in the sky. Computer processing of data received by the antenna receives the radio sky high image resolution and quality in a very short period of time. It uses two types of antennas, one for low (10-80MHz) and the other for high frequencies (110-240MHz).

LOFAR is an international project with the infrastructure being built or already built in Germany, Fancuskoj, UK and Sweden. All stations are connected to the central office for receiving and processing data that is located in Dwingeloo, near Groningen, where supercomputer processing data, creating the best images of the universe in the radio field. It is planned that the system is fully operational in the autumn of this year.

The American spacecraft Solar Dynamics Observatory (SDO) designed the study began with the sun sending scientific data about the Sun. The first pictures show the sun with the details that previously could not take no spacecraft or terrestrial telescope. The first photo was submitted by the sun made the SDO show many complex chemical and physical processes taking place in the sun.

Modern cameras recorded every 0.75 seconds, the Sun and the Earth day will be sent to 1.5 TB of data. To illustrate this is a day about the same amount of data to memory as the computer took the 400-odd movies! However, for the time when the spacecraft was in Earth's shadow will be short "break from a busy" looking at the sun.
SDO has in recent months geosinhronu placed in orbit high above Earth. Its launch weight of 3100kg, 1400kg of waste that the rocket fuel that will operate the aircraft position in space, while the rest belongs to the structure, solar panels, communication systems, computers and the weight of scientific instruments around 270kg.
Even with four special telescopes, which are the materials for the media of water as a unique instrument, SDO observes the Sun in nine target areas of the electromagnetic spectrum, with an emphasis on research in the field of UV EMSA.
SDO also observes the entire solar disk, and just received the results show how big an improvement over the known SOHO spacecraft, which since 1995. The research has the task of the Sun, and even the recently launched twin spacecraft STEREO-A and B..
SDO is a key component of a large project, "Living with the Sun" (Living With a Star) they want to find evidence of the interdependence of life on Earth against the events on the Sun. Earth system - the sun is in constant interaction and we want to know how and what exactly happens and with what consequences for our planet and life on it.
SDO was launched on 11th February this year, the Atlas V rocket with raketodroma in Florida.

Yesterday, 18 March at 12:25 CET U.S. astronaut Jeffrey Williams and Russian cosmonaut Maxim Surayev successfully into space aboard Soyuz TMA-16 landed on Earth in the northeast of the town of Arkalyk in the Kazakh steppe. After 169 days stay in space to Issa, the duo landed on Earth and feel well said from Moscow control center. Rescue teams quickly arrived at the landing spaceship, and the crew of a helicopter was able to capture the moment and I am launching Soyuz TMA-16 on the icy-snowy Kazakh steppe.

Rescuers helped out astronauts from the spaceship, and after a long stay in space followed by their adaptation to the demanding conditions under the influence of Earth's gravity.

ISS these days in the evening we can see with the naked eye as preljeće over our region as a bright, traveling "stars". Soyuz-type spacecraft was introduced four decades as a piloted spacecraft to fly astronauts into space in the return to Earth.
